This seems to be buildit related or buildkit specific. |
This looks similar to the issue described here where we run into a timeout because buildkit does not register the job in time. That would explain why limiting parallelism works around the problem (i.e. because it reduced the slowdown so the operation does not time out). |
moby/buildkit#2088 (comment) is fixed, so I'm closing this issue as well As a side note, you can limit the number of concurrent builds using |
